Rosiclare is a city in Hardin County, Illinois. It is located along the Ohio River. The population was 980 at the 2020 census.

Elizabethtown is a village in and the county seat of Hardin County, Illinois, United States, along the Ohio River. The population was 220 at the 2020 census. Elizabethtown is situated 2½ miles east of Daisy Mine.
